WellMade celebrates its first anniversary

More than 1000 brand employees have attended 45 WellMade sessions.
WellMade project supported by European Union

In the past year the WellMade team was present at 30 events in 10 countries. In the next two years, another 80 WellMade seminars will take place throughout Europe at fashion fairs as well as within companies.

Procurement professionals can have a significant impact on improving working conditions in the textile industry. Therefore CNV Internationaal decided to participate in the development of the WellMade project, that shows them how to use that influence

At fairs across Europe, designers, salespeople, buyers and other brand employees can join free interactive WellMade seminars. Through graphics and high-tech features, apparel employees learn what they can do in their day-to-day work to improve working conditions in clothing factories.

How to motivate suppliers to implement labour standards

Through innovative seminars and a supporting website, WellMade helps procurement officers in dealing with social criteria. On fashion fairs throughout Europe visitors and exhibitors learned how to motivate their suppliers to respect and implement labour standards – and ensure that they do. They received hands on tools to have a positive impact on labour conditions in clothing supply chains.

Quality goes hand in hand with demands to include social criteria

The WellMade project not only aims at garment professionalls it also offers procurement version too, as in today’s procurement landscape the demands for price and quality go hand in hand with demands to include social criteria in tender processes.
